Motorola introduced three new RAZRs a couple of weeks ago but it seems like they're not done yet. Just recently, Motorola introduced a new member of the RAZR family, the Intel-powered RAZR i.

Ini adalah RAZR sehingga tidak jauh berbeda dari yang lain. Ia dilengkapi layar edge-to-edge 4,3 inci (960x540) AMOLED dengan Gorilla Glass, rangka aluminium kelas pesawat, kamera 8 megapiksel, 2000 mAh baterai, bagian belakang Kevlar khas, dan Android Android 4.0 Ice Cream Sandwich (dapat ditingkatkan ke Jelly Bean).

Apa yang membedakan RAZR i dari yang lain adalah prosesor Intel Atom Z2460 terbaru yang berkecepatan 2.0 GHz di dalamnya. Ini berarti kinerja lebih cepat seperti mengambil 10 foto dalam kurang dari satu detik dalam mode multi-shot. Ia juga dilengkapi NFC dan lapisan pelindung splash-guard untuk melindungi RAZR i dari hujan atau tumpahan tidak sengaja.

RAZR i akan tersedia di Eropa dan Amerika Selatan mulai Oktober dengan versi putih yang akan hadir di pasar tertentu.

Tidak ada detail tentang harga dan ketersediaan lokal saat ini.
